A 'jam session' arranged by Pat Dixon and Bill Ward.
Duncan Whyte (trumpet), Woolf Phillips (trombone), Kathleen Stobart (saxophone), Nat Temple (clarinet), George Firestone (drums), Frank Deniz (guitar), Dick Katz (piano), Coleridge Goode (double bass), Roy Marsh (vibra-harp)

A first visit to The Intimate Theatre' Palmers Green (by permission of Frederick Marlow) to see George and Margaret, a comedy by Gerald Savory.
